Employment outlook for business services workers

The employment outlook for business services workers is relatively positive. New jobs are expected to be created in the largest occupational groups within this sector. In particular, there is a growth expected in professional workers such as healthcare practitioners and engineers. In addition, the government is increasingly outsourcing management functions to professional employer organizations and temporary staffing firms. These services include human resources management, risk management, accounting, and information technology. Additionally, there will be an increase in marketing jobs as temporary staffing firms compete for the best clients.

Costs of business services

Business services often include variable costs. These expenses vary based on the amount of output produced. These costs include direct labor, materials, utilities, commissions, bonuses, and time. Depending on the service or product, these costs can vary by the hour. Here are some tips to calculate the cost of a business service. Be sure to include variable costs as well as direct costs. These costs will make calculating the cost of business services easier.

First, you’ll need to calculate your overhead. This is an important step in determining how much your business costs. You’ll need to set a price that will cover all of your business expenses. Once you’ve determined how much your business costs, you can calculate your hourly rate. For example, if you spend $4,000 a month on overhead, you should charge a minimum of $25 per hour. You’ll need to consider your staff’s salaries and benefits when determining how much you’ll charge for your services.
